Fan Switches
A fan switch is a critical component of your vehicle's cooling system, responsible for activating the electric cooling fan when the engine reaches a predetermined temperature. A faulty switch can lead to overheating, poor A/C performance, or a fan that runs constantly. Our collection covers a range of thermal and electric fan switches designed to meet or exceed OEM specifications.
Whether you need a direct replacement for a failed factory part or a performance-oriented adjustable switch, we carry options from trusted manufacturers. Key features to consider include:
- Temperature set point (typically in °F or °C) – determines when the fan turns on
- Thread size and pitch for proper fitment in the radiator, cylinder head, or intake manifold
- Durable construction with corrosion-resistant terminals and sealed connectors
- Some switches include multiple terminals for dual-speed fan control or A/C integration
Replacing your fan switch is often a straightforward job. Always verify the correct temperature rating and thread specifications for your application. If you're troubleshooting an overheating issue, check the switch with a multimeter before condemning other components.

Ensure your cooling system operates at peak efficiency with the SPAL Variable Temperature Control Sensor. Specifically engineered for use with SPAL brushless fans, this sensor provides precise thermal management by adjusting fan output based on engine coolant temperature.
Operating within a 190°F to 215°F range, this sensor enables progressive fan speed control rather than a simple on/off cycle. This variable functionality reduces electrical load on the alternator, minimizes fan noise during light driving, and maintains consistent operating temperatures for high-performance applications.
- Designed exclusively for SPAL brushless fan systems
- Temperature Operating Range: 190°F to 215°F
- Enables variable speed signaling for optimized thermal regulation
- High-accuracy thermal probe for reliable engine monitoring
Maintain precise thermal management with the SPAL Variable Temperature Control Sensor, engineered specifically to interface with SPAL brushless cooling fans. Unlike standard on/off switches, this sensor provides the variable input necessary for the fan's internal controller to modulate speed based on real-time cooling requirements.
- Temperature Range: 175°F to 195°F (79°C to 91°C)
- Compatibility: Designed exclusively for use with SPAL brushless fan systems
- Variable Control: Enables fan speed ramping to reduce electrical load and fan noise
- Construction: Durable brass housing with high-accuracy thermal sensing element
This sensor monitors coolant temperatures within the 175-195 degree window, allowing the brushless fan to gradually increase its RPM as heat rises. This variable operation prevents the harsh amperage spikes associated with traditional relay-controlled fans and ensures more consistent engine operating temperatures.
